Who are the Britain’s Got Talent finalists?

Blackouts

Dance group Blackouts come from Switzerland and are known for their terrific staging and LED outfits.

Vinnie McKee

Scottish singer-songwriter Vinnie McKee’s powerful vocals have been a hit with fans, earning him a place in next week’s final.

Olly Pearson

Aged just 11 years old, guitarist Olly made his way through to the finals by receiving a golden buzzer.

Stacey Leadbeatter

Supermarket worker Stacey received a golden buzzer from KSI in her auditions for her powerful vocal performance, and she is through to the finals.

Jasmine Rice

Jasmine Rice is an opera singer and drag queen who captivated audiences with her rendition of Never Enough from The Greatest Showman.

Ping Pong Pang

Ping Pong Pang is a dance group that incorporates ping pong into their routines.

They previously made it to the final of Italy’s Got Talent.

Joseph Charm

Stand-up comedian Joseph Charm received the gold buzzer treatment for his funny routine.

Hear Our Voice

Hear Our Voice is a choir made up of victims from the Post Office Scandal, and they made their way into the final through public vote.

Harry Moulding

Magician Harry Moulding made history with his action-packed performance that included a live proposal.

Binita Chetry

Binita Chetry wowed audiences in the last of the semi-finals of the competition with her acrobatic dancing.

When is the Britain’s Got Talent 2025 final and how to watch

The BGT final airs next Saturday on May 31.

Starting at 7pm, it’ll air for a whopping two hours and 45 minutes, making the grand finale longer than most movies.

Viewers can tune in live on ITV1 and via ITVX.

The talent show had an extended run this year, with a switch-up in the format meaning the semi-finals aired once weekly as opposed to each night across one week only.
